Weather & Climate in Buqei‘a, Israel

Temperature, precipitation, air quality, natural hazards, and monthly weather data.

Buqei‘a enjoys a temperate climate with an average annual temperature of 64°F (18°C). Winters average 50°F in January while summers reach 79°F in July. The area gets 347 sunny days per year, well above the U.S. average of 205 / making it one of the sunnier locations in the country. Annual precipitation totals 25.5 inches (drier than the 38-inch national average). The area receives 1.1 inches of snow annually. The city sits at an elevation of 1,854 feet.

Monthly Weather

Month Avg Temperature Precipitation Summary
January 50°F (10°C) 6.5 in Coldest, Wettest
February 51°F (10°C) 5.0 in
March 55°F (13°C) 3.4 in
April 62°F (17°C) 1.3 in
May 69°F (21°C) 0.4 in
June 75°F (24°C) 0.0 in Driest
July 79°F (26°C) 0.0 in Warmest
August 78°F (26°C) 0.0 in
September 76°F (24°C) 0.1 in
October 70°F (21°C) 0.8 in
November 61°F (16°C) 3.1 in
December 52°F (11°C) 5.2 in

Buqei‘a has a seasonal temperature swing of 29°F / from 50°F in January to 79°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 25.9 inches, with January being the wettest month (6.5") and June the driest (0.0").
